    Most of the voice change begins around puberty. [4] Adult pitch is reached 2–3 years later, but the voice does not stabilize until the ages of 21-25 It usually happens months or years before the development of significant facial hair. Under the influence of sex hormones (namely testosterone), the voice box, or larynx, grows in both sexes ...

    On average, the male voice deepens by one octave while the female voice lowers by a few semitones. [7] The fundamental frequency (pitch) of an adult female typically falls between 165 and 255 Hz and an adult male between 85 and 180 Hz. [8] Anatomical changes during puberty include enlargement of the larynx for both sexes.

    A vocal register is a range of tones in the human voice produced by a particular vibratory pattern of the vocal folds. These registers include modal voice (or normal voice), vocal fry, falsetto, and the whistle register. [1] [2] [3] Registers originate in laryngeal function.
